the food probe on the recent blast chillers is a NTC 10K probe, try Hawco or Tempatron Ltd. its a right angle stab stainless stab probe that you are after

You could try Thrmofrost Cryo. I bought a Dixell XB500 controller (the same one is fitted to some Foster chillers albeit with less options and with a different cover) and the probes were about £45 for the insert probe and a fiver for the evaporator one.
